‘UNLIKE MILLS, AKUFO ADDO IS NOT HUMAN’ – BRIGADIER NUNOO MENSAH

-

Brigadier General Joseph Nunoo-Mensah intimates President Addo Dankwa Akufo-Addo is not human.

But rather, the former Chief of Defence Staff of the Ghana Armed Forces say Akufo-Addo, unlike former president, John Evans Atta Mills, the late, is a politician.

He asserts humans are truthful, dissimilar to politicians who lie their way to power and do things different from their professions prior to ascending into office.

Speaking with Captain Smart on Onua TV/FM’s Maakye Monday, August 15, 2022, Brig. Gen. Nunoo-Mensah said he was President Akufo-Addo’s campaign manager in 1998, but left to follow Prof. Mills because the latter was truthful.

“I was Nana Addo’s campaign manager in 1998. I toured the whole country with him. I left and supported Mills. Mills was human not a politician. Akufo-Addo is a politician. Mills was truthful. Politicians are not truthful. Humans are truthful. Mahama is a politician, Kufuor is a politician. All of them except Mills,” he responded one after the other when Captain Smart asked him.

He continued that the motive of every politician is seeking favour from the electorates to perpetuate their parochial interest after getting power.

“Politicians want favour. They don’t think about anybody. They lie their way to power,” he indicated.

Meanwhile, he has chastised both the New Patriotic Party and the National Democratic Congress for taking Ghana for granted rather than prioritising the development of the nation after all the years of being in power.

“None of these two parties [NPP, NDC] can help Ghana. Apart from Nkrumah, nobody loved Ghana passionately,” he noted, adding that Prof. Mills loved Ghana but couldn’t get the time to do more before his demise.
